The Power of Innovation: Revolutionizing the Fashion Industry

In today’s fast-paced and ever-evolving world, the fashion industry stands at the forefront of innovation. From design and manufacturing to marketing and retail, innovation plays a pivotal role in shaping the future of fashion. This article explores why innovation is crucial in the fashion industry and how it drives growth, competitiveness, and sustainability.

1. Driving Creativity and Differentiation:
Innovation fuels creativity in the fashion industry, enabling designers to push boundaries and create unique, trend-setting styles. By embracing new materials, technologies, and techniques, fashion brands can differentiate themselves from competitors and captivate consumers with fresh and exciting designs. From 3D printing to sustainable fabrics, innovative solutions inspire creativity and pave the way for groundbreaking fashion trends.

2. Meeting Consumer Demands:
Innovation is essential for meeting the ever-changing demands of consumers. In today’s digital age, consumers have become more informed, discerning, and conscious of their choices. They seek personalized experiences, sustainable practices, and seamless integration of technology in their fashion choices. By embracing innovation, fashion brands can stay ahead of these demands, offering customized products, sustainable practices, and immersive shopping experiences that resonate with consumers.

3. Enhancing Sustainability:
The fashion industry is notorious for its environmental impact, but innovation offers a pathway to sustainability. By adopting eco-friendly materials, implementing efficient manufacturing processes, and exploring circular economy models, fashion brands can reduce their carbon footprint and contribute to a more sustainable future. Innovation in sustainable fashion not only benefits the environment but also attracts environmentally conscious consumers who prioritize ethical practices.

4. Streamlining Supply Chain and Operations:
Innovation plays a crucial role in optimizing the fashion industry’s complex supply chain and operations. From inventory management systems to data analytics, technology-driven innovations streamline processes, reduce costs, and improve efficiency. By embracing automation, artificial intelligence, and blockchain technology, fashion brands can enhance transparency, traceability, and responsiveness throughout the supply chain, ensuring timely delivery and minimizing waste.

5. Embracing Digital Transformation:
Innovation in the fashion industry goes hand in hand with digital transformation. From e-commerce platforms to virtual reality fashion shows, technology-driven innovations have revolutionized the way fashion brands engage with consumers. By leveraging social media, influencers, and data analytics, brands can gain valuable insights into consumer preferences, tailor marketing strategies, and deliver personalized experiences. Digital innovation enables fashion brands to reach a global audience, break geographical barriers, and stay relevant in the digital era.
